Taylor Swift

Taylor Alison Swift is an American singer-songwriter. She is known for narrative songs about her personal life, which have received widespread media coverage. At age 14, Swift became the youngest artist signed by the Sony/ATV Music publishing house and, at 15, she signed her first record deal.

Her 2006 eponymous debut album was the longest-charting album of the 2000s in the US. Its third single, "Our Song", made her the youngest person to single-handedly write and perform a number-one song on the Billboard Hot Country Songs chart. Swift's second album, Fearless, was released in 2008.

Buoyed by the pop crossover success of the singles "Love Story" and "You Belong with Me", it became the US' best-selling album of 2009 and was certified diamond in the US. The album won four Grammy Awards, and Swift became the youngest Album of the Year winner.

Taylor Swift Joins Haim for New Version of Sister Trio’s ‘Gasoline’

Chris Willman Music WriterThe sister trio Haim has managed to make its song “Gasoline” even more inflammatory with the edition of a special guest, Taylor Swift, on a new version released late Thursday.Swifties had been salivating since earlier in the day when the group posted a short video of singer Danielle Haim singing along with the song while promising: “gasoline remix ft ???

out today.” The triple question marks in question were immediately understood to stand in for Swift, since none of the band’s other high-profile collaborators would have stood up to that kind of half-day-long tease in the end.The “Gasoline” remix marks the returning of a favor, or reversal of a spotlight, since Haim made a featured appearance on Swift’s “Evermore”.
